**Q: How do I seed realistic fixtures with Fabrikon?**

Fabrikon is our test-data factory library, maintained by the Quillview platform team. Define a blueprint per model, then call `Fabrikon.build` for in-memory objects or `Fabrikon.create` to persist. Avoid hardcoding sequence values; Fabrikon handles uniqueness automatically. Blueprints live in `spec/blueprints` and must stay deterministic so CI snapshots match. To regenerate the shared fixture vault locally, you'll need the team recovery passphrase, which is:

unlock words, kadug-tahog: casax-holath

CI note for eng sync: the Bellwick alert deduplicator started double-firing after Tuesday's pipeline change. Root cause: fingerprint hashing ran before label normalization, so identical alerts hashed differently. Fix reorders the steps and adds a regression test. Patched build is green on all three runners. Trace token for the fixed run follows.

pipeline stamp: htk31_f769b577b3028a4e9958e5bb8d1259a

## Runbook: Remindlet Appointment Job

Hey plugin folks — the Remindlet reminder job for Calloway Clinic runs every 20 minutes and batches patients by appointment window. Your plugin hooks fire after the batch is built but before messages send, so you can rewrite templates or drop entries, but you can't add recipients. If the job stalls, check that your hook returns within the 5-second budget; slow hooks get skipped, not retried. When filing an issue, include the trace token shown just below.

build token for fajof-yahof: htk4_869f

## ExamGate Queue — Limits & Quotas

The ProctorNine exam queue enforces hard caps to prevent session flooding during exam windows. Per-candidate enqueue is rate-limited; institutions get pooled quotas. Exceeding any cap returns a throttle response, never silent drops. All limits are enforced at the Varnholt edge layer before auth, so unauthenticated probes cannot exhaust proctor capacity. Quota changes require sign-off from the queue owners and a load test against the Saltmere staging pool. Current enforced constants are listed below.

tuning constants:
QUOTAS = {
    "druwyn": 5,
    "holix": 5,
    "zorath": 5,
    "holwyn": 10,
}